Shrimp Scampi Pasta Bake


Set the oven to 400°F (200°C) to heat up while preparing the pasta and shrimp.

Cook the pasta:
Boil the linguine pasta according to the package instructions. Once cooked, drain and set aside.

Sauté the shrimp:
In a large oven-safe skillet, melt butter and olive oil over medium heat. Add the garlic and red pepper flakes, cooking for about 1 minute until fragrant. Add the shrimp and cook for 3-5 minutes until pink and opaque.

Deglaze the pan and simmer:
Pour in grape juice and lemon juice, scraping up any browned bits from the bottom of the pan. Let the sauce simmer for a few minutes until it thickens slightly.

Combine and bake:
Stir in the cooked pasta, chopped parsley, and half of the Parmesan cheese.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ven and bake for 10-15 minutes until bubbly and heated through.

Finish the dish:
Remove from the oven, sprinkle with the remaining Parmesan cheese and bread crumbs. Broil for 1-2 minutes until the top is golden brown and crispy.
